For the Base

  • Ground Meat: Beef or a combination for a rich, meaty flavor. Ground turkey or chicken works well for a leaner option.
  • Onion and Garlic: For aromatic depth.
  • Tomato Sauce and Crushed Tomatoes: A combination of these creates a flavorful base. You can use marinara sauce for extra seasoning.
  • Lasagna Noodles: Broken into smaller pieces to fit into the pot and cook evenly.

For the Creamy Layers

  • Ricotta Cheese: Adds creaminess and mimics traditional lasagna layers.
  • Mozzarella Cheese: For that signature melty, cheesy goodness.
  • Parmesan Cheese: A sprinkle of Parmesan adds a salty, nutty finish.

For Flavor

  • Italian Seasoning: A blend of basil, oregano, and thyme enhances the dish’s flavor.
  • Vegetables (Optional): Zucchini, spinach, or mushrooms can be added for a nutritional boost.
  • Chicken or Beef Broth: Helps cook the pasta and creates a flavorful sauce.

How to Make Quick and Easy One-Pot Lasagna: A Comfort Food Classic Made Simple

Step 1: Choose Your Pot

Start by selecting a deep pot or Dutch oven; this ensures you have enough space to layer all your delicious ingredients together. Using the right pot helps with even cooking and makes stirring easy!

Step 2: Cook the Aromatics

In your chosen pot over medium heat, add some olive oil and sauté chopped onions until they become translucent. Adding minced garlic right after will fill your kitchen with an irresistible aroma—this step builds the flavor foundation of your lasagna!

Step 3: Brown Your Meat

Next, add in your ground meat of choice. Cook until browned; this step adds richness to your dish. If you’re using lean ground turkey or chicken, ensure it’s cooked through while retaining moisture.

Step 4: Add Sauces and Noodles

Pour in both tomato sauce and crushed tomatoes along with broken lasagna noodles. Stir everything together so that every noodle gets coated in that luscious sauce. This creates the heart of your one-pot meal!

Step 5: Incorporate Cheeses

Now comes the fun part! Mix in ricotta cheese until it’s well combined—this will add creaminess throughout. Then sprinkle mozzarella generously on top; it’ll melt beautifully as everything simmers.

Step 6: Simmer Away

Pour in chicken or beef broth to help cook those noodles perfectly al dente. Let it all simmer gently on low heat while you occasionally stir; this helps meld those flavors together while keeping things nice and saucy.

Step 7: Finish with Parmesan

Just before serving, sprinkle that final touch of Parmesan cheese on top. Allow it to melt slightly—it’ll give your lasagna that delightful salty contrast we adore!

And there you have it! Your Quick and Easy One-Pot Lasagna is ready to serve—perfectly cheesy, hearty, and utterly comforting!

Make Ahead and Storage

This Quick and Easy One-Pot Lasagna is perfect for meal prepping, allowing you to enjoy delicious comfort food throughout the week. Here’s how to store and reheat your lasagna for maximum flavor and convenience.

Storing Leftovers

  • Allow the lasagna to cool completely before storing.
  • Transfer to an airtight container or cover tightly with plastic wrap.
  • Store in the refrigerator for up to 3-4 days.

Freezing

  • Portion out any leftover lasagna into individual servings.
  • Wrap each portion tightly in plastic wrap, then place in a freezer-safe bag or container.
  • Freeze for up to 2-3 months for best quality.

Reheating

  • Thaw frozen portions in the refrigerator overnight before reheating.
  • To reheat, place in the microwave on medium power until heated through, about 2-3 minutes.
  • Alternatively, reheat in a preheated oven at 350°F (175°C) for about 20 minutes, covering with foil to keep moisture in.

FAQs

Can I make Quick and Easy One-Pot Lasagna ahead of time?

Yes! You can prepare the lasagna ahead of time and store it in the refrigerator or freezer. Just be sure to follow proper storage guidelines and reheat before serving.

What can I substitute for ricotta cheese in Quick and Easy One-Pot Lasagna?

If you don’t have ricotta cheese, you can use cottage cheese or a dairy-free alternative like tofu blended with nutritional yeast for a similar creamy consistency.

How long does Quick and Easy One-Pot Lasagna last in the fridge?

When stored properly, this lasagna can last in the refrigerator for up to 3-4 days. Be sure to keep it covered to maintain freshness.

Ingredients

  • Ground beef or turkey
  • Onion
  • Garlic
  • Tomato sauce
  • Crushed tomatoes
  • Lasagna noodles
  • Ricotta cheese
  • Mozzarella cheese
  • Parmesan cheese
  • Italian seasoning
  • Chicken or beef broth

Instructions

  1. Choose a deep pot and heat olive oil over medium heat.
  2. Sauté chopped onions until translucent; add minced garlic.
  3. Brown your choice of ground meat until fully cooked.
  4. Pour in tomato sauce and crushed tomatoes; add broken lasagna noodles.
  5. Mix in ricotta cheese; top with mozzarella cheese.
  6. Add chicken or beef broth and let simmer on low heat until noodles are tender.
  7. Finish with a sprinkle of Parmesan cheese before serving.
